Specs
CPUHexa-core (4×2.4Ghz Cortex-A73 + 2×2.0Ghz Cortex-A53)
CPU Instruction setARMv8-A NEON + Crypto (64-bit)
GPUMali-G52 (Hexa-core @ 800Mhz)
RAM4GiB DDR4 (1320Mhz PC4-21333 @ 1.2V)
Size100mm×91mm×25mm (with heatsink)
Audio1×3.5mm Stereo + 1×HDMI Digital Audio + 1×SPDIF Optical
BluetoothNo
EthernetGigabit (Realtek RTL8211F)
Expandable storage1×microSD UHS-I SDR104 (up to 2 TiB, DS/HS modes)
GPIO40-pin@3.3V (SPI,UART,I2C,SPDIF,ADC,VDDIO)
IRYes (Built-in)
Power consumption2.2W idle/6.2W max.
Power source5.5mm barrel jack (12VDC×2A)
Release DateApril 6, 2020
SoCAmlogic S922X (12nm)
USB4×USB-A 3.0 Host + 1×Micro-A USB 2.0 OTG
Video out1×HDMI 2.0 + 1×Composite Video (3.5mm jack)
Video resolution4K/2160p@60Hz (HDR, CDC, EDID)
Weight200g
Wi-FiNo
eMMCYes (up to 128GiB)
